Abstract :
A method and results of an experimental test of the time stability of the half-life of alpha-decay 214Po nuclei are presented. Two underground installations aimed at monitoring the time stability have been constructed. Time of measurement exceeds 1038 days for one set up and 562 days for the other. It was found that the amplitude of a possible annual variation of 214Po half-life does not exceed 0.33% (90% C.L.) of the mean value. The limit on the deviation of the decay curve from exponent at 0.034 × T 1 / 2 < t < 0.1 × T 1 / 2 range has been found.
